Job Overview We're looking for a Product Manager in our Capture Engineering team with a deep understanding of both hardware and software systems to lead the development of integrated software ...
Job Overview We're looking for a Product Manager in our Capture Engineering team with a deep understanding of both hardware and software systems to lead the development of integrated software ...
Component Engineer
Calgary, AB · On-site
Review technical data sheets to assess Digital and RF hardware design fit * Reviewing components ... Electrical Engineer Degree or Electronics Engineering Technical diploma with 1 to 3 years ...
Component Engineer
Calgary, AB · On-site
Review technical data sheets to assess Digital and RF hardware design fit * Reviewing components ... Electrical Engineer Degree or Electronics Engineering Technical diploma with 1 to 3 years ...
... generation hardware AI accelerators. They are enhancing their software to ensure seamless ... Requirements: * Degree in Computer Science, Engineering, or related field. * 5+ years of AI ...
Quick apply
... generation hardware AI accelerators. They are enhancing their software to ensure seamless ... Requirements: * Degree in Computer Science, Engineering, or related field. * 5+ years of AI ...
... generation hardware AI accelerators. They are enhancing their software to ensure seamless ... Requirements: * Degree in Computer Science, Engineering, or related field. * 5+ years of AI ...
Quick apply
... generation hardware AI accelerators. They are enhancing their software to ensure seamless ... Requirements: * Degree in Computer Science, Engineering, or related field. * 5+ years of AI ...
Bachelor's degree in Electrical Engineering, Computer Engineering, Math, or Physics * Deep knowledge of embedded hardware and software development. * Demonstrated expertise in writing, with the ...
Bachelor's degree in Electrical Engineering, Computer Engineering, Math, or Physics * Deep knowledge of embedded hardware and software development. * Demonstrated expertise in writing, with the ...
Reporting to the Engineering Manager , Transmission Lines , this position can be located in any of ... OPGW/ADSS, insulators, hardware accessories and fittings). * Direct experience on the safety ...
Reporting to the Engineering Manager , Transmission Lines , this position can be located in any of ... OPGW/ADSS, insulators, hardware accessories and fittings). * Direct experience on the safety ...
Perform routine maintenance and upgrades on SCADA hardware and software * Conduct system testing and validation to ensure accuracy and reliability * Collaborate with engineers and field technicians ...
Quick apply
Perform routine maintenance and upgrades on SCADA hardware and software * Conduct system testing and validation to ensure accuracy and reliability * Collaborate with engineers and field technicians ...
Perform routine maintenance and upgrades on SCADA hardware and software * Conduct system testing and validation to ensure accuracy and reliability * Collaborate with engineers and field technicians ...
Perform routine maintenance and upgrades on SCADA hardware and software * Conduct system testing and validation to ensure accuracy and reliability * Collaborate with engineers and field technicians ...
Perform routine maintenance and upgrades on SCADA hardware and software * Conduct system testing and validation to ensure accuracy and reliability * Collaborate with engineers and field technicians ...
Perform routine maintenance and upgrades on SCADA hardware and software * Conduct system testing and validation to ensure accuracy and reliability * Collaborate with engineers and field technicians ...
Perform routine maintenance and upgrades on SCADA hardware and software * Conduct system testing and validation to ensure accuracy and reliability * Collaborate with engineers and field technicians ...
Quick apply
Perform routine maintenance and upgrades on SCADA hardware and software * Conduct system testing and validation to ensure accuracy and reliability * Collaborate with engineers and field technicians ...
Perform routine maintenance and upgrades on SCADA hardware and software * Conduct system testing and validation to ensure accuracy and reliability * Collaborate with engineers and field technicians ...
Quick apply
Perform routine maintenance and upgrades on SCADA hardware and software * Conduct system testing and validation to ensure accuracy and reliability * Collaborate with engineers and field technicians ...
Perform routine maintenance and upgrades on SCADA hardware and software * Conduct system testing and validation to ensure accuracy and reliability * Collaborate with engineers and field technicians ...
Perform routine maintenance and upgrades on SCADA hardware and software * Conduct system testing and validation to ensure accuracy and reliability * Collaborate with engineers and field technicians ...
Staff Research Scientist - VLM / VLA
Mountain View, AB · On-site
CA$218K - CA$335K/yr
Provide technical mentorship and long-term vision to a multidisciplinary group of machine learning engineers, software developers, and hardware specialists. * Foster internal innovation by ...
Staff Research Scientist - VLM / VLA
Mountain View, AB · On-site
CA$218K - CA$335K/yr
Provide technical mentorship and long-term vision to a multidisciplinary group of machine learning engineers, software developers, and hardware specialists. * Foster internal innovation by ...
Mechanical Engineer (Key Roles: Production,Hardware Design,Maintenance/Reliability,Project Controls, orImprovementEngineer ) You will fill one of several technical resource roles where you will ...
Mechanical Engineer (Key Roles: Production,Hardware Design,Maintenance/Reliability,Project Controls, orImprovementEngineer ) You will fill one of several technical resource roles where you will ...
... early hardware samples. * In depth knowledge of C, C++ and assembly. * Understanding of GPU architecture and GPU programming using HIP or CUDA. * Automation of configuration environments, test ...
... early hardware samples. * In depth knowledge of C, C++ and assembly. * Understanding of GPU architecture and GPU programming using HIP or CUDA. * Automation of configuration environments, test ...
... engineers to identify End User needs and define ergonomic problem spaces. Your focus will include hardware design, reach and accommodation analysis, and the integration of products into vehicles and ...
Quick apply
... engineers to identify End User needs and define ergonomic problem spaces. Your focus will include hardware design, reach and accommodation analysis, and the integration of products into vehicles and ...
... hardware Qualifications * University Degree in Civil/Structural Engineering or equivalent experience * Minimum of five (5) years of experience and a history of working in Transmission projects.
... hardware Qualifications * University Degree in Civil/Structural Engineering or equivalent experience * Minimum of five (5) years of experience and a history of working in Transmission projects.
Transmission Line Civil Engineer
Calgary, AB · On-site
... hardware Qualifications * University Degree in Civil/Structural Engineering or equivalent experience * Minimum of five (5) years of experience and a history of working in Transmission projects.
Transmission Line Civil Engineer
Calgary, AB · On-site
... hardware Qualifications * University Degree in Civil/Structural Engineering or equivalent experience * Minimum of five (5) years of experience and a history of working in Transmission projects.
Senior Automation Engineer
Acheson, AB · On-site
Relay Programming & Configuration: Develop and create complex relay setting files, including ... Responsible for selecting relay hardware and developing technical proposals that account for ...
Senior Automation Engineer
Acheson, AB · On-site
Relay Programming & Configuration: Develop and create complex relay setting files, including ... Responsible for selecting relay hardware and developing technical proposals that account for ...
Programming experience with a variety of automation software and hardware. * Willingness to travel to support maintenance and commissioning tasks. * Availability for PLC, SCADA Systems, and related ...
Programming experience with a variety of automation software and hardware. * Willingness to travel to support maintenance and commissioning tasks. * Availability for PLC, SCADA Systems, and related ...
Hardware Developer information
See Alberta salary details
$26.5K - $38.5K
3% of jobs
$38.5K - $50.5K
8% of jobs
$50.5K - $62.5K
3% of jobs
$62.5K - $74.5K
3% of jobs
$78.3K is the 25th percentile. Wages below this are outliers.
$74.5K - $86.5K
25% of jobs
The median wage is $95.5K / yr.
$86.5K - $98.5K
11% of jobs
$98.5K - $110.5K
11% of jobs
$110.5K - $122.5K
4% of jobs
$134.1K is the 75th percentile. Wages above this are outliers.
$122.5K - $134.5K
8% of jobs
$134.5K - $146.5K
13% of jobs
$146.5K - $158.5K
12% of jobs
$26.5K
$102.2K
$158.5K
How much do hardware developer jobs pay per year?
How does a Hardware Developer typically collaborate with software and testing teams during product development?
What are hardware developers?
What is the difference between Hardware Developer vs Hardware Engineer?
| Aspect | Hardware Developer | Hardware Engineer |
|---|---|---|
| Required Credentials | Bachelor's in Electrical Engineering, Computer Engineering, or related fields | Bachelor's or higher in Electrical Engineering, Computer Engineering, or related fields |
| Work Environment | Designing, prototyping, and testing hardware components | Design, development, and optimization of hardware systems |
| Industry Usage | Used across electronics, consumer devices, and embedded systems | Common in electronics, telecommunications, and computer hardware industries |
| Common Search/Comparison | Often compared with Hardware Engineer due to overlapping roles | Related but more focused on system integration and optimization |
Hardware Developers focus on designing and prototyping hardware components, while Hardware Engineers work on developing, testing, and optimizing complete hardware systems. Both roles require similar educational backgrounds and are integral to electronics and tech industries, but their specific responsibilities differ slightly.
What are the key skills and qualifications needed to thrive as a Hardware Developer, and why are they important?
Full-time
Posted yesterday
Job description
- Define and drive the roadmap for software systems that support real-time operations, automation, and carbon certification generated by our facilities.
- Collaborate with our process, hardware, and software engineering teams as well as our operations teams to deeply understand system behaviors and requirements.
- Translate high-level company objectives into clear software product specifications and user stories.
- Own the full lifecycle of software products from ideation and requirements gathering to launch and iteration.
- Develop tools that ingest, process, and visualize data from sensors, control systems, simulations, hardware-in-the-loop, and prototype systems.
- Coordinate with certification and compliance teams to ensure software supports traceable and verifiable carbon accounting.
- Integrate R&D and operational datasets into digital twin models to inform next-gen facility design and technology optimization.
- Bachelor's degree in related STEM discipline
- 5+ years of product management experience in climate tech, industrial tech, or in deep tech domains like aerospace, robotics, autonomous systems.
- Strong technical background engineering degree or hands-on experience working with hardware + software systems.
- Ability to work in a fast paced, autonomously driven, and demanding atmosphere.
- Ability to assess risk and make design and development decisions without all available data.
- Proven track record of building products that interface with physical systems (IoT, robotics, automation, or similar).
- Experience with industrial data acquisition systems, SCADA, or control software is a plus.
- Familiarity with software development processes, data pipelines, and cloud-based infrastructure.
- Willing to work extended hours and weekends as necessary
- Some travel required